The Basics of Egg Noodles
Egg noodles are made from a mixture of wheat flour, eggs, and water, creating a rich and tender noodle that is ideal for various dishes. Unlike regular wheat noodles, egg noodles contain more protein and fat due to the addition of eggs, giving them a distinct yellow hue and a delightful, hearty taste. They cook quickly—usually in under five minutes—making them a staple in many households.
Cooking Quick Cook Egg Noodles
One of the most appealing aspects of egg noodles is their ease of preparation. To cook quick cook egg noodles, simply follow these steps
1. Boil Water Start by bringing a pot of salted water to a rolling boil. The salt not only enhances the flavor of the noodles but also helps to keep them from sticking together.
2. Add Noodles Once the water is boiling, add the quick cook egg noodles. Stir gently to separate them and prevent clumping.
3. Cook Allow the noodles to cook for about 4-5 minutes, depending on the package instructions. It's essential to taste them around the 4-minute mark to achieve the desired tenderness.
4. Drain and Rinse Once cooked, drain the noodles in a colander and rinse them briefly under cool water. This step stops the cooking process and washes away excess starch.
5. Serve Quick cook egg noodles are now ready to be served in your favorite dish, whether stir-fried, in soups, or tossed with a sauce.
Versatile Meal Ideas
The true beauty of quick cook egg noodles lies in their versatility. Here are several delicious ways to enjoy them
1. Stir-Fried Egg Noodles Heat a tablespoon of oil in a large skillet or wok. Add your choice of protein—chicken, shrimp, or tofu—along with a medley of vegetables like bell peppers, carrots, and snap peas. Stir-fry until cooked through. Toss in the cooked egg noodles along with soy sauce, sesame oil, and a sprinkle of green onions for a quick, satisfying meal.
2. Noodle Soup For a comforting bowl of soup, simmer a broth of your choice—chicken, vegetable, or miso—with sliced mushrooms, broccoli, and bok choy. Once the vegetables are tender, stir in the cooked egg noodles and serve hot, garnished with fresh herbs.
3. Creamy Noodle Casserole Combine cooked egg noodles with a creamy sauce made from cheese, milk, and your choice of cooked meat or vegetables. Transfer to a baking dish, top with breadcrumbs, and bake until golden and bubbling for a hearty casserole.
4. Cold Noodle Salad For a refreshing meal, toss the cooled noodles with julienned cucumbers, shredded carrots, and bell peppers. Drizzle with a dressing made from soy sauce, rice vinegar, sesame oil, and a touch of honey. Garnish with sesame seeds and chopped cilantro for a vibrant salad.
Nutritional Benefits
Quick cook egg noodles not only offer culinary versatility but also pack a nutritious punch. They provide a good source of carbohydrates, which are essential for energy, while the addition of eggs contributes valuable proteins and healthy fats. This balance makes them an excellent choice for a quick meal that sustains your energy levels throughout the day.
